    Just bought this yesterday & even though I'm wary of Asian ceramics-I liked it and for $20,what the heck ?
    It's 10 1/2" tall,in perfect shape, and my significant other likes it :rolleyes::D.
    How could it be so minty ? Good old Gotheborg gave me this answer-'This (stamped not signed) mark is found on Satsuma sold on US military bases in 1947 to service members,tourist members and relatives'.
    Still love the piece,but this is why I'm a committed cheapskate re: things I'm clueless about,(they're legion !).

    PS-With my extremely limited knowledge,I'd guess a true vintage Japanese piece would generally have a bit more amber glaze,more and slightly browner craquelure,a painted not stamped signature,plus obviously more ware.
    There's prob a lot more indications I'm not aware of (?).
